Output 16602622553fd49018e4692233c4f6381189d707853387a856104798339e4eea:3

value
40418450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e626ed30062b5e5cbbee4a594ea0176395a48b5 OP_EQUAL
address
MDb23ZYh2BcxFVJ1ukDmtwbtrbZgt6YBzG
transaction
16602622553fd49018e4692233c4f6381189d707853387a856104798339e4eea
spent
true